Antun Gustav Matos (Tovarnik, June 13, 1873 – Zagreb, March 17, 1914) was a Croatian poet, novelist, columnist, essayist and travel writer. He is considered one of the best Croatian writers.
Sculpture "Matos on the bench" by Ivan Kozarić located on Strossmayer promenade in the center of Zagreb and is an indispensable item in the tourist walking around old town. The sculpture was placed at its current location in 1972. It is made of aluminum. The reason is in the very center of the city is that it is Matos, although he was born in Zagreb, very loved and appreciated this town. Since the Strossmayer Promenade is located in the Upper Town of "Matos perspective" offers a view of almost the entire city including the home of his parents, which is located in Jurjevska Street.
